AnalyzeRegistry

Package to analyze the prevalence of documentation, testing and continuous integration in Julia packages in a given registry.

Installation

The package works on Julia v1.6 and following versions. NOTE: the package requires having Git installed and available in the PATH.

To install the package, in Julia's REPL, press ] to enter the Pkg mode and run the command

add https://github.com/giordano/AnalyzeRegistry.jl

Alternatively, you can run

using Pkg
Pkg.add("https://github.com/giordano/AnalyzeRegistry.jl")

Usage

The main functionality of the package is the analyze function:

julia> analyze(joinpath(general_registry(), "F", "Flux"))
Package Flux:
  * repo: https://github.com/FluxML/Flux.jl.git
  * is reachable: true
  * has documentation: true
  * has tests: true
  * has continuous integration: true
    * GitHub Actions
    * Buildkite

The argument is the path to the directory of the package in the registry, where the file Package.toml is stored. The function general_registry() gives you the path to the local copy of the General registry.

NOTE: the Git repository of the package will be cloned, in order to inspect its content.

The returned value is the struct Package, which has the following fields:

struct Package
    name::String # name of the package
    repo::String # URL of the repository
    reachable::Bool # can the repository be cloned?
    docs::Bool # does it have documentation?
    runtests::Bool # does it have the test/runtests.jl file?
    github_actions::Bool # does it use GitHub Actions?
    travis::Bool # does it use Travis CI?
    appveyor::Bool # does it use AppVeyor?
    cirrus::Bool # does it use Cirrus CI?
    circle::Bool # does it use Circle CI?
    drone::Bool # does it use Drone CI?
    buildkite::Bool # does it use Buildkite?
    azure_pipelines::Bool # does it use Azure Pipelines?
    gitlab_pipeline::Bool # does it use Gitlab Pipeline?
end

To run the analysis for multiple packages you can either use broadcasting

analyze.(packages)

or use the method analyze(packages::AbstractVector{<:AbstractString}) which leaverages FLoops.jl to run the analysis with multiple threads.

You can use the function find_packages to find all packages in a given registry:

julia> find_packages(general_registry())
4312-element Vector{String}:
 "/home/user/.julia/registries/General/C/CitableImage"
 "/home/user/.julia/registries/General/T/Trixi2Img"
 "/home/user/.julia/registries/General/I/ImPlot"
 "/home/user/.julia/registries/General/S/StableDQMC"
 "/home/user/.julia/registries/General/S/Strapping"
 [...]

Do not abuse of this function!
